7 Qualities of Top Culinary Chefs

October 19, 2009 by Louise

Becoming a top culinary chef is not an easy task. Reaching the summit in a culinary arts career requires several years of hard work, sincere devotion, creative thinking, innovative approach and constant practice. An intense competition exists in the field of top culinary chefs and the top chefs are in great demand in the finest restaurants around the world. Some of the major qualities that top chefs need to have are presented here.

qualities_chefs

1. Culinary arts passion
A tremendous passion towards food and cooking is the foremost quality that makes a good chef stand out. These chefs really enjoy their profession. Right from the selection of the food items that they wish to prepare according to the function, event or situation, to the creation of appropriate menus and the preparation of each item with great care, they do it with unrequited love and affection.

2. Creativity in culinary arts
Great chefs differ from other chefs not only because of their passion, but also due to their distinctive creativity. Apart from the standard ingredients in a food item, they add a few more special ingredients and make minor changes in the preparation methods, so that the food item appears totally new. When several such subtly modified food items are presented in a menu, the dining experience will be a pleasant and enjoyable one for the customers.


3. Commitment to quality in culinary arts
Renowned chefs select only the finest and best ingredients and adopt methods and techniques that will result in very high quality food items. They never compromise on quality. Even if they find minor faults or defects in an ingredient, they never hesitate to discard that item – even if it is a costly one.

4. Constant practice and effort for innovation
The world’s most famous chefs never cease to practice their cooking techniques and continuously try to hone their skills. They are forever on the lookout for innovative food items and techniques, and practice them until they achieve complete perfection.

5. Importance of teamwork
Great chefs know that they can never prepare all the food items single-handedly. That’s why they collaborate and coordinate with other members of the culinary arts profession – in a harmonious fashion as a smooth team. This will not only make the other members in the food preparation work feel part of the team and gain inspiration to offer more commitment in their job, but the relationship between the management and staff will also be very healthy.

6. Paying attention to minute details
When a particular food item is prepared, each ingredient is important and the quantity in which it should be added is even more significant. If an ingredient is either totally missed or if it is added in lesser or more quantity, the food item will not have the right taste. Hence, the top chef should keep an eye on every small detail that is part of the culinary arts work.

7. Quick decisions and handling criticism
Major chefs need to make instant decisions when problems arise or when a few particular customers wish to have special dishes that can not be prepared instantly. Since time is an important factor in the food industry, quick decisions to solve the problems or complaints and special requests from customers should be taken by the chef. Even if there’s criticism from customers, the chef should take them calmly – as it’s never possible to satisfy everyone all the time. Still, if there was a genuine mistake in the preparation of a food item, the chef should not hesitate to apologise sincerely and profusely. If possible, the chef should try to offer a suitable alternative that the customer will accept without objection.
